Planning a Private Island Wedding: Tips and Considerations
Planning a private island wedding requires careful consideration and attention to detail. Here are some essential tips to keep in mind:
- Choose the right island: Research and select a private island that meets your budget, guest list, and wedding vision.
- Determine your budget: Set a realistic budget and allocate funds for island rental, catering, accommodations, and other expenses.
- Select a venue: Choose a venue that suits your wedding style, whether it's a beachside resort, a luxurious villa, or a secluded cove.
- Hire a professional wedding planner: A seasoned wedding planner can help you navigate the planning process, ensure a smooth execution, and provide valuable recommendations.
- Consider logistics: Think about transportation, accommodations, and amenities for your guests, as well as island regulations and restrictions.

Private Island Wedding Costs: What to Budget For
The cost of a private island wedding can vary greatly, depending on the island, venue, and services required. Here's a rough breakdown of expenses to expect:
| Category | Estimated Cost |
|---|---|
| Island Rental | $5,000 - $50,000 |
| Catering and Beverages | $3,000 - $15,000 |
| Accommodations and Amenities | $2,000 - $10,000 |
| Wedding Planner and Services | $1,500 - $5,000 |
| Decorations and Flowers | $1,000 - $3,000 |

Private Island Wedding Insurance: Why It's Essential
Cancellations, postponements, or unexpected events can wreak havoc on a private island wedding. Having adequate insurance coverage can provide peace of mind and financial protection. Here are some reasons why:
- Coverage for cancellations and postponements
- Protection against vendor failures and supplier issues
- Insurance for weather-related damage and loss
- Liability insurance for accidents and injuries
